Redis缓解系统负载的出色之处(redis的方法)
Redis在近几年大受关注,它是一种高性能的key-value内存数据库,广泛应用于Web应用开发中。相比于其它的传统数据库Manager System,它具有更高的性能优势,可以帮助在软件系统中加快处理速度。其中,Redis缓解系统负载的出色之处在于:
首先,由于Redis是基于内存来存储的,内存的读写速度比硬盘的要快的多,而I/O Hypervisor技术可以有效的提升传输效率,并把系统负载减轻到极致。其次,Redis通过“由来已久”的分布式缓存策略对不同类型的数据进行分类管理,以有效的缓解系统负载。此外,Redis可以根据不同的计算需求,自动调整缓存的大小,有效的把负载降低到最低。
再次,Redis还提供了多级缓存和缓存更新机制,在系统加载多个请求时,可以有效的进行缓存,把请求分发到多个优化过的Redis实例,大大减轻系统负载。此外,它还支持自动迁移、数据缩放、数据恢复等功能来源持可用性。
最后,Redis支持超高性能,提供了一系列功能来有效的搭建高性能应用,并有效的缓解系统负载。它还支持丰富的命令集,可以实现有效的数据存储和处理,灵活定制,大大提升了应用软件的性能。
综上所述,Redis缓解系统负载的出色之处在于:基于内存存储构建分布式缓存,自动调整缓存的大小,多级缓存,缓存更新机制,超高性能等等。Redis的出色性能也给Web开发带来了非常大的帮助,可以有效的缓解系统负载,提高效率。